WebA 100-gram (3.5 ounces) serving of shrimp has 101 milligrams of potassium, making it one of the low potassium meats. Canned light tuna has 176 milligrams of potassium per 100-gram serving. It’s important to know that many canned tunas have added phosphorus, so be sure to read the labels to avoid unhealthy additives. WebNov 22, 2024 · Slice vegetable 1/8 inch thick Rinse in warm water for a few seconds Soak for a minimum of 2 hours in warm unsalted water using ten times the amount of water to the amount of vegetable. For example, 1 cup of vegetable requires 10 cups of water. If soaking longer, change the water every four hours. Rinse under warm water again for a few seconds.
